Pull shockrod to
bottom position
before to ll the
shock body with
the supplied shock
absorber oil..
BLEEDING
Slowly move the
shockrod up and
down to let all
airbubles
escape.
After assembly ensure
you can push the piston
all the way in (top of
balljoint should hit the
shock-bottom). If not,
re-open the shock and
let some oil bleed out,
and repeat the steps.
Allow some ‘rebound’ on
the shockshaft, around
4mm is normal.
